Abstract
In the present work the magnetic and electronic structure of 2Fe/Pd an d 2Pd/Fe multilayers are analyzed by means of the linear muffin-tin or bital method (LMTO). The calculations were carried out for several lat tice parameters in order to obtain the total energy as a function of t he volume. At the theoretical equilibrium volume, we found a high magn etic moment at Fe sites for 2Pd/Fe (mu(Fe) similar to 3.0 mu(B)) and 2 Fe/Pd (mu(Fe) similar to 2.7 mu(B)) multilayers. The analysis of the d ensity of states at equilibrium gives a good understanding of the beha vior of the 2Fe/Pd and 2Pd/Fe magnetization. The hyperfine field at ir on nuclei is near -39.0 T for 2Pd/Fe multilayer and has a lower value( -21.0 T) for 2Fe/Pd system. The results for the magnetic moments and h yperfine parameters at different lattice spacing show a strong depende nce of the magnetic properties of the 2Fe/Pd system with pressure.
